[PROBLEMS] To provide a safety device that enables safety and quick escape of residents in an emergency in a three-story or higher building.
A semi-circular fan framed in spring-like metal is installed in a building in a closed state, switched on in the event of an emergency such as a fire, and a motor 13 is activated to remove the fan's fasteners. By fully opening the fan with force and sticking it to the magnet attached to the outer wall, residents will not feel afraid of heights, stand on the fan, connect ladders and descend from fan to fan one after another, high-rise building It was made possible to escape from quickly. Also, even if the ladder can't be used, fans can help.

本考案は、三階建以上のビルディングの外壁窓辺下方に取り付けた、扇状の安全装置に関するものである。  The present invention relates to a fan-shaped safety device attached to the lower side of an outer wall window of a three-story or higher building.

従来、高層ビルディングの火災などの緊急時において、エレベーターや階段が使用不可能になった場合、住民はパニックにおちいり、窓から直接飛び降りて地面に叩きつけられ大怪我をしたり、あるいは死亡したりする例が過去に何度となく見られた。将来、都市に高層ビルディングの数はますます増え、同様の事故が多くなっていくことが危惧される。  Conventionally, in the event of an emergency such as a fire in a high-rise building, if the elevator or stairs become unavailable, the residents will panic and jump directly from the window and hit the ground, resulting in serious injury or death. Examples have been seen many times in the past. In the future, the number of high-rise buildings in the city will increase, and there are concerns that similar accidents will increase.

従来の緊急脱出装置の梯子はふつう、ベランダ片隅などめだたない裏に設置されているが、火災で煙に巻かれた場合、梯子までたどりつき冷静にそれを使いこなすことはむずかしい。
高所恐怖から、それを使えないことも多い。パニックと高所恐怖、これが克服すべき課題である。従って、表通りなど大通りに面した、消防車や見守る人々の援助も得られる場所で、高所恐怖をそれほど感じずに、迅速に脱出する装置を設置し、過去の脱出方法の欠点を解決しようとするものである。
The ladders of conventional emergency escape devices are usually installed behind the corners of the veranda, but if you are caught in smoke by fire, it is difficult to reach the ladder and use it calmly.
Because of fear of heights, it is often impossible to use it. Panic and fear of heights are challenges to overcome. Therefore, in a place where you can get assistance from fire trucks and people on the main street, such as the main street, install a device that quickly escapes without feeling so much fear of altitude, and tries to solve the disadvantages of past escape methods. To do.

本考案は、扇(ファン)の形態をヒントに、扇状の軽金属、あるいは非可燃性の化学化合物を素材にほぼ半円形のものを作り、強力なばねにより全開するそのファンを、閉じた形で、各階の外壁窓辺下方に備え付けるというものである。緊急時、住民は窓から出て全開したファンの上に乗り、ファンの中央部の穴から、外壁に設置された梯子をつたって降りることで、恐怖心は薄らぐ。ファンの大きさを、下段にいくにしたがって大きくすることで、万一梯子が使えない時も、ファンからファンへと跳び降りることができる。高所から落ちる衝撃は、そのつど和らげられる。高所恐怖が薄らぐこと、ファンごとに降りる途中で休めること、梯子が使えない万一の場合も落下の衝撃が大きく和らげられることなどの利点から、従来の脱出方法の欠点は解決される。  The present invention uses a fan shape as a hint to make a fan-shaped light metal or non-flammable chemical compound as a semi-circular material, and the fan that is fully opened by a powerful spring is closed. It is to be installed below the window on the outer wall of each floor. In an emergency, the residents get out of the windows and ride on the fan that is fully open, and then get down from the hole in the center of the fan through the ladder installed on the outer wall. By increasing the size of the fan as you go down, you can jump from fan to fan even if the ladder is not available. The impact of falling from high places is alleviated each time. The disadvantages of conventional escape methods are solved by the advantages such as less fear of heights, resting on the way of each fan, and the ease of falling shock in the event of a ladder failure.

上述のファンを各階ごと、あるいは数階ごとに設置することで、高層ビルディングにすむ人々の、緊急時に対する日常の不安は軽減される。また、消防車で救出にあたる人々も、クレーンなどを使う作業がしやすくなり、脱出はより安全、迅速になる。  By installing the above-mentioned fans on each floor or on several floors, people who live in high-rise buildings can alleviate daily anxiety about emergencies. In addition, people who are rescued by fire trucks can easily work with cranes, making escape safer and faster.

Hereinafter, an embodiment will be described with reference to the accompanying drawings. Reference numeral 1 is a light metal or a fan (fan) body formed in a semicircular shape by an appropriate material such as a non-flammable chemical compound, and 1a and 1b are metal pieces having a toughness attached to the body.
1c, 1d The first solid line and the wavy line aligned therewith are folding mountains. The folded mountain portion is made of a thin and strong metal wire. The equal angle is 22.5 degrees from the solid line to the solid line, and only 10 degrees near the wall. The reason for the 10 degree portion is that when the fan is fully opened, there is a margin in length so that it reaches the outer wall portion with the magnet attached. Depending on the material, the angle should be smaller.
2 is a fixed part to the outer wall, and the material is a strong metal. The angle is 22.5 degrees, and it is folded in half at the fold mountain beforehand and used in double. 2a and other circular holes are for fixing screws, and are fixed to the metal plate installed on the outer wall with screws. 2b is a thin and strong metal spring, and a 2c portion at the tip is fixed to 2. The opposite 2d portion hangs down in the air with the entire spring when the fan is fully opened.
Reference numeral 3 denotes a portion to be brought into close contact with a metal plate installed on the outer wall when the fan is fully opened. The size and the angle are the same as 2; A strong magnet is attached to the metal plate on the outer wall. Alternatively, the entire plate is a magnet. Reference numerals 4, 5, 6, and 7 denote metal wires slightly inward from the circular edge of the fan, and the portions 4a, 5a, 6a, and 7a are fixed to a metal plate that is installed on the outer wall in advance. 7 has three magnet portions 7b, 7c and 7d. The entire fan is normally installed in the shape of a folded bar on the outer wall of each floor. For the color, the smart part is the same color as the outer wall, and the open part is white or light green.

8はファン本体を折りたたんだ状態にしておく留め具で、8a、8b部分は磁石となっており、外壁に取り付けた金属板9、10、にそれぞれ引き付けられ密着している。金属線4、5、6、7は先端部4a、5a、6a、7aが一点に集められ、外壁に取り付けた金属板にあらかじめ固定されている。緊急の際、スイッチの12を入れると電流が流れ、モーターの13に巻きつけた金属線の14が強い力で引っ張られて8の留め具がはずれ、外壁に取り付けた15の枠に引っかかる。ファンは2dを先端部とするばねの力、およびファン本体の橋のばねの力によって急激に開き、反対側の外壁に磁石を取り付けた金属板17に引き付けられ、3の部分が密着する。その際、ゴム板をつけた受け台18が、密着部を支える。7も外壁の磁石部17a、17b、17cに密着する。  Reference numeral 8 denotes a fastener that keeps the fan body in a folded state. The portions 8a and 8b are magnets that are attracted to and closely contact the metal plates 9 and 10 attached to the outer wall. The metal wires 4, 5, 6, and 7 are gathered at one end 4 a, 5 a, 6 a, and 7 a and fixed in advance to a metal plate attached to the outer wall. In an emergency, when the switch 12 is turned on, current flows, the metal wire 14 wound around the motor 13 is pulled with a strong force, the 8 fasteners come off, and it catches on the 15 frame attached to the outer wall. The fan is suddenly opened by the spring force of 2d at the tip and the bridge spring force of the fan body, and is attracted to the metal plate 17 having a magnet attached to the opposite outer wall, and the portion 3 is brought into close contact. At that time, the cradle 18 with a rubber plate supports the contact portion. 7 is also in close contact with the magnet portions 17a, 17b and 17c on the outer wall.

各階のファンが開くのを確認したら、スイッチを切り、モーター作動を止める。スイッチは一階外壁部はじめ、各階内部、外部に適宜設置する。住民は窓から戸外に脱出し、ファンの上に立ち、穴の部分16から、外壁に設置された梯子をつたって降りる。この装置は、消防車が入りこめる道路に面した外壁にあることが望ましい。なお、平常時は、一階部分の梯子は囲いで覆い、使用不可とする。なお、磁石部はじめ全装置の点検は、定期的に行う。  When the fans on each floor are confirmed to open, switch off and stop the motor operation. Switches are installed as appropriate on the first floor outer wall, inside and outside each floor. Residents escape outside through the window, stand on the fan, and descend from the hole 16 through a ladder installed on the outer wall. The device is preferably located on the outer wall facing the road where the fire engine can enter. During normal times, the ladder on the first floor is covered with a fence and cannot be used. Inspect all magnets and other equipment regularly.
